TMZ has released video where Chappelle can be heard talking about the attacker’s injuries and appears to be happy about the outcome.
“I felt good my friends broke his arm,” Chappelle is heard saying in the video.
Those words could cost Chappelle if a civil suit is filed.
“It is very possible that Dave Chappelle’s own words, where he says that he roughed the guy up, can be used against him in a potential civil manner down the line,” Triessl said.
The Hollywood Bowl may not be off the hook either.
Despite confiscating patrons’ cell phones ahead of the show, the security team somehow missed a replica gun that contained a knife blade.
“The Hollywood Bowl or the promoters involved in this show, including Netflix, may be facing civil liability for their lapse of security. Something went very wrong here,” Triessl said.
